💡
原文英文,约600词,阅读约需3分钟。
📝
内容提要
编写有效的.lyc文件需遵循特定语法和结构规则,包括层次结构块、注释、全局变量声明、@layer块、标准CSS规则、块嵌套、指令@mixin、@include和@extend、平衡的{}块以及避免无效字符。这些规则确保文件有效。
🎯
关键要点
- 编写有效的.lyc文件需遵循特定语法和结构规则。
- 文件必须组织成层次结构块,包括全局变量、CSS规则和特殊指令。
- 注释遵循JavaScript或CSS的约定,单行注释以//开头,多行注释用/*和*/包围。
- 全局变量必须在文件开头或特定块内声明,变量名以--开头。
- 使用@layer块组织CSS规则,层名必须是有效标识符。
- CSS规则遵循标准语法,值可以引用全局变量。
- 块可以嵌套以表示选择器之间的层次关系,每个嵌套块必须正确封闭。
- 特殊指令包括@mixin(定义可重用代码块)、@include(包含已定义的mixin)和@extend(继承属性)。
- 所有{}块必须正确平衡,缺失的{或}会导致编译错误。
- 不允许在.lyc文件中使用不可打印或无效字符,这些字符在预处理时会被移除。
- 遵循这些规则,.lyc文件将有效并能被编译器或预处理器正确处理。
❓
延伸问答
如何编写有效的.lyc文件?
有效的.lyc文件需遵循特定的语法和结构规则,包括层次结构块、全局变量声明、@layer块和标准CSS规则等。
.lyc文件中的全局变量如何声明?
全局变量必须在文件开头或特定块内声明,变量名以--开头,格式为--variable-name: value;
@layer块的作用是什么?
@layer块用于将CSS规则组织成层,层名必须是有效标识符,块内容需用{}正确封闭。
.lyc文件中如何使用注释?
注释遵循JavaScript或CSS的约定,单行注释以//开头,多行注释用/*和*/包围。
如何避免在.lyc文件中出现编译错误?
确保所有{}块正确平衡,避免使用不可打印或无效字符,这些字符会在预处理时被移除。
.lyc文件中可以使用哪些特殊指令?
可以使用@mixin定义可重用代码块,@include包含已定义的mixin,@extend继承属性。
➡️